The controversial fame of Russian oligarchs has long since spilled beyond the borders of the country where they amassed their fortunes. The whole world gossips about them, sometimes laughing, sometimes condemning, yet always taking their money with pleasure. But what do they think of themselves? Austrian sociologist Elisabeth Schimpfössl, who has lived in London, the oligarch capital, for fifteen years, conducted a hundred interviews with Russia's richest people and their associates to find the answer. From her book, you will learn how the oligarchs explain their insane wealth, what they teach their children, and what they plan to do in the new reality where they will have to choose between a comfortable life in the West and preserving their Russian assets.
